7. Challenges Overcome

Individuals from Delaware aspiring to reach the NBA face unique hurdles stemming from the state’s smaller population, limited basketball infrastructure, and reduced national exposure. These challenges necessitate exceptional dedication and strategic navigation of available resources. The lack of large-scale AAU programs, common in more basketball-centric states, often requires Delaware players to seek opportunities outside of the state to gain significant competitive experience. Securing attention from college recruiters also demands proactive efforts, as Delaware players may be overlooked due to the state’s lower profile in the national basketball landscape. For example, an individual who proactively contacted college coaches and attended out-of-state showcases despite financial constraints embodies the type of determination required.

The financial burdens associated with pursuing a professional basketball career can also disproportionately affect players from Delaware. Travel expenses for tournaments, specialized training costs, and access to high-quality facilities can present significant obstacles. Overcoming these financial limitations often involves relying on community support, fundraising efforts, and personal sacrifices. Furthermore, the absence of a readily available network of NBA alumni within Delaware can make navigating the complexities of professional basketball more difficult. Lacking mentorship and guidance from experienced players requires Delaware aspirants to be resourceful in seeking advice and developing strategies for success. The support from a small community becomes especially important for helping players who may have limited access to elite training facilities or established basketball networks.

Insights for Aspiring Basketball Players from Delaware

Guidance distilled from the experiences of individuals who have successfully transitioned from Delaware to the NBA. These tips emphasize proactive strategies and resourcefulness to overcome geographical and demographic limitations.

Tip 1: Maximize Exposure Through Strategic Competition: Participate in high-level tournaments and showcases outside of Delaware to increase visibility among college recruiters. Focus on events known for attracting college scouts and NBA talent evaluators.

Tip 2: Cultivate Strong Relationships with Coaches: Develop strong relationships with high school and AAU coaches who can advocate for you and connect you with college programs. Seek mentorship from experienced coaches who have a track record of developing talent.

Tip 3: Proactively Engage with College Recruiters: Do not rely solely on coaches for recruitment. Directly contact college coaches, send highlight reels, and attend college prospect camps. Take ownership of the recruitment process.

Tip 4: Prioritize Skill Development: Focus relentlessly on fundamental skill development, including shooting, dribbling, passing, and defensive techniques. Seek out specialized training to refine weaknesses and enhance strengths.

Tip 5: Seek out-of-state Competitive Leagues to play: Since there are fewer competitive leagues to compete in inside the state of Delaware, it is important to make sure to be part of competitive leagues in other states in the region.

Tip 6: Emphasize Academic Excellence: Maintain strong academic standing to increase college recruitment opportunities. A strong GPA can open doors to a wider range of colleges and scholarship possibilities.

Tip 7: Build a Strong Social Media Presence: Create a professional social media profile showcasing your skills, achievements, and character. Use social media to connect with coaches, recruiters, and other players.

Tip 8: Network with Current and Former Players: Connect with current and former NBA players from Delaware or the surrounding region for mentorship and guidance. Learn from their experiences and seek advice on navigating the path to professional basketball.
